Pete B Posted March 8, 2013 Share Posted March 8, 2013 It's a well-established system that has worked for me - the Visa scheme is called Chargeback. You can claim any amount as long as you start the claim within 120 days from the purchase. It's not unknown for local branches to express ignorance of the scheme, so you may have to insist a bit...
